Data AI · Lakehouse
Currently tracking 66 active AI roles, down 30% versus the prior 4 weeks. Primary focus: Agent · Engineering. Salary range $130k–$425k (avg $220k).
| Title | Stage | AI score |
|---|---|---|
| Senior Software Engineer - Distributed Data Systems Databricks is seeking a Senior Software Engineer to build the next generation of distributed data storage and processing systems. This role involves working on core components like Apache Spark, Data Plane Storage, Delta Lake, and Delta Pipelines, focusing on performance, scalability, and reliability for diverse data workloads including ETL and data science. | — | 0 |
| Senior Software Engineer - Backend Databricks is seeking a Senior Software Engineer - Backend to build infrastructure and products for their data and AI platform. The role involves working on various backend domains including serverless platforms for Gen AI workloads, core cloud infrastructure, partner integrations, notebook experiences for data science and ML, and application platforms for internal engineers. The ideal candidate will have production-level experience in backend development, distributed systems, and cloud technologies. | — | 0 |
| — |
| 0 |
| Staff Software Engineer - Backend Databricks is seeking a Staff Software Engineer - Backend in Bengaluru, India, to work on their AI infrastructure platform. The role involves developing backend services, distributed data systems, and potentially full-stack features, focusing on large-scale distributed systems, SaaS platforms, and service-oriented architectures. Experience with languages like Python, Java, Scala, or C++ and a BS in Computer Science are required. | — | 0 |
| Senior Software Engineer (Backend) Software Engineer (Backend) at Databricks, focusing on building and scaling the company's data and AI infrastructure platform. The role involves developing foundational infrastructure, cloud-agnostic abstractions, and tools to enhance engineering efficiency, particularly optimizing the Rust development experience. | — | 0 |
| Engineering Manager - Compute Infra Engineering Manager to lead a team responsible for critical components of Databricks' compute platform, which runs all Data, AI and stateful workloads across all major clouds. The platform launches millions of VMs daily and must deliver extreme elasticity, reliability, and cost efficiency. | — | 0 |
| Staff Software Engineer - Distributed Data Systems Databricks is seeking a Staff Software Engineer to build the next generation of distributed data storage and processing systems. This role involves working on large-scale software platforms, including Apache Spark, Delta Lake, and Delta Pipelines, to support diverse workloads ranging from ETL to data science. The ideal candidate will have extensive experience with distributed systems, databases, and big data technologies. | — | 0 |
| Staff Software Engineer - Distributed Data Systems Databricks is seeking a Staff Software Engineer to work on their distributed data systems, focusing on building and running their data and AI infrastructure platform. The role involves developing next-generation distributed data storage and processing systems, with projects including Apache Spark, Data Plane Storage, Delta Lake, Delta Pipelines, and Performance Engineering. The ideal candidate has extensive experience in distributed systems, databases, and big data systems. | — | 0 |
| Staff Software Engineer - Database Engine Internals Databricks is seeking a Staff Software Engineer to work on the core database engine internals, focusing on building next-generation query engines and structured storage systems. The role involves designing and implementing systems for query compilation, optimization, distributed execution, vectorized engines, data security, resource management, transaction coordination, and efficient storage structures to support diverse workloads from ETL to data science within their unified data and AI platform. | — | 0 |
| Staff Software Engineer - Database Engine Internals Databricks is seeking a Staff Software Engineer to work on the core database engine, focusing on query compilation, optimization, distributed execution, and storage structures. The role is part of a team building a next-generation query engine and structured storage system to support diverse workloads from ETL to data science within their unified platform. | — | 0 |
| Solutions Architect - Montreal Solutions Architect role at Databricks focused on designing data architectures using Databricks technology, partnering with sales to drive customer adoption and technical discussions throughout the sales lifecycle. Responsibilities include developing account strategies, presenting reference architectures, and consulting on big data, data engineering, and data science/ML projects. | — | 0 |
| Sr. Software Engineer - Performance Databricks is seeking a Sr. Software Engineer focused on Performance to join their team. This role involves evaluating product performance, identifying bottlenecks, and collaborating with engineers to solve performance and scalability issues within their large-scale data and AI infrastructure platform. Responsibilities include setting performance targets, developing benchmarks, conducting competitive analysis, and working with customers to resolve production performance problems. | — | 0 |
| Sr. Software Engineer - Performance Databricks is seeking a Sr. Software Engineer focused on performance to join their team. This role involves evaluating product performance, identifying bottlenecks, and collaborating with engineers to solve performance and scalability issues across their large-scale data and AI infrastructure platform. Responsibilities include setting performance targets, developing benchmarks, analyzing competitive performance, and mitigating performance problems for customers. | — | 0 |
| Staff Software Engineer - Backend Databricks is seeking a Staff Software Engineer - Backend to work on their data and AI infrastructure platform. The role involves designing, implementing, testing, and operating micro-services for the platform, focusing on backend development with languages like Scala/Java, data pipelines, and cloud integrations. The role is not directly building AI models but supporting the infrastructure for data and AI teams. | — | 0 |
| Staff Software Engineer - Backend Databricks is seeking a Staff Software Engineer - Backend to work on their data and AI infrastructure platform. The role involves designing, implementing, testing, and operating micro-services for the Databricks platform, focusing on large-scale distributed systems, data pipelines, and cloud integrations. The engineer will contribute to various teams such as Data Science and Machine Learning Infrastructure, Compute Fabric, Data Plane Storage, Enterprise Platform, Observability, Service Platform, or Core Infra. | — | 0 |
| Senior Software Engineer - Backend Databricks is seeking a Senior Software Engineer - Backend to work on infrastructure and products for their data and AI platform. The role involves building scalable, reliable services and infrastructure for big data and machine learning workloads, with a focus on distributed systems and cloud technologies. | — | 0 |
| Senior Software Engineer - Fullstack Full Stack Software Engineer at Databricks to build and scale the Data Intelligence Platform, focusing on enabling data teams to derive insights from data, from data loading to production deployment of statistical models. The role involves creating simple workflows for compute clusters, data pipelines, and SQL-based data exploration and dashboarding experiences. | — | 0 |
| Senior Software Engineer - Infrastructure and Tools Senior Software Engineer focused on building and extending the core Databricks infrastructure platform, which supports Big Data and AI workloads. Responsibilities include architecting multi-cloud systems, improving software development workflows, and developing automated build, test, and release infrastructures. | — | 0 |
| Senior Software Engineer - Fullstack Full Stack Software Engineer at Databricks, a data and AI company, focusing on building and scaling their Data Intelligence Platform. The role involves working on the full product lifecycle from data loading to deploying production artifacts, with an emphasis on user experience, robust and scalable product development, and enabling customers to derive insights from data. | — | 0 |
| Senior Software Engineer - Backend Databricks is seeking a Senior Software Engineer - Backend to work on infrastructure and products for their data and AI platform. The role involves building scalable, reliable services and infrastructure for big data and machine learning workloads, with a focus on distributed systems and cloud technologies. | — | 0 |
| Engineering Manager - Backend Engineering Manager for backend infrastructure and platform services at Databricks, focusing on resource management, scalable services, and tools for engineers operating across clouds and environments. The role involves hiring, team development, technical standards, roadmap planning, and cross-team coordination. | — | 0 |
| Senior Software Engineer - Database Engine Internals Databricks is seeking a Senior Software Engineer to work on the internals of their database engine, focusing on next-generation query engines and structured storage systems. The role involves designing and implementing systems for query compilation, execution, optimization, data security, resource management, and storage structures to support diverse workloads including ETL and data science. | — | 0 |
| Senior Software Engineer - Distributed Data Systems Databricks is seeking a Senior Software Engineer to build the next generation of distributed data storage and processing systems. This role involves working on projects like Apache Spark, Delta Lake, and Delta Pipelines, focusing on performance, scalability, and reliability for diverse data workloads including ETL and data science. The ideal candidate has 5+ years of production experience in Java, Scala, or C++, with a strong foundation in algorithms, data structures, and distributed systems. | — | 0 |